LAHORE – Opposition leader in Punjab Assembly Hamza Shahbaz Sharif faces a setback from the Accountability Court.
An accountability court in Lahore has extended judicial remand of Opposition Leader Hamza Shahbaz till October 16 in money laundering and Ramazan Sugar Mills cases.
Accountability Court judge Jawad Ul Hassan heard the case. Hamza Shehbaz presented before court after judicial remand ends today. The court has directed NAB to re-produce the PML-N leader on October 16.
The security had been beefed up on Hamza Shahbaz’s court appearance. Roads adjacent to the accountability court had been blocked and irrelevant persons were not allowed to enter the premises.
